Luciano Tovoli shot Suspiria using one of the last imbibition Technicolor prints, flooding the dance academy with unnatural gel light — primary reds, electric blues and sickly greens laid on with theatrical excess. There is no naturalism here; colour is pure sensation, deep and saturated to the point of menace.
Recipes
Red Corridor
The blood-red lit hallways and stairwells
Film SimulationVelvia/Vivid
GrainWeak/Small
Color ChromeStrong
CC FX BlueOff
White BalanceIncandescent
WB ShiftR+5 / B-1
Dynamic RangeDR400
Highlight+0
Shadow+2
Color+4
Sharpness+1
Noise Reduction-2
Clarity+2
ISOISO 400–800
Blue Interior
The electric blue-gel rooms
Film SimulationVelvia/Vivid
GrainWeak/Small
Color ChromeStrong
CC FX BlueStrong
White BalanceShade
WB ShiftR-3 / B+5
Dynamic RangeDR400
Highlight+0
Shadow+2
Color+3
Sharpness+1
Noise Reduction-2
Clarity+1
ISOISO 400–800
Green Glow
The sickly green-lit passages
Film SimulationVelvia/Vivid
GrainWeak/Small
Color ChromeStrong
CC FX BlueWeak
White BalanceFluorescent 2
WB ShiftR-2 / B+0
Dynamic RangeDR400
Highlight+0
Shadow+2
Color+3
Sharpness+0
Noise Reduction-2
Clarity+1
ISOISO 800
